### Shared Canteen Arrangements

The canteen on the ground floor of Merrowgate House is shared with Pellard & Vance, the firm occupying the east wing. Their staff access it via the connecting door by the servery. You may use the canteen from 08:00 to 15:00; seating is first come, first served. The connecting door must remain closed outside mealtimes. To return to our wing, the stairwell door requires the code below.

staff pass of tagef-kawif = bdg-CD-0

# Siftshade Environments

Siftshade is the bloom filter we park in front of the Corvid key-value store so cold lookups don't hammer it. Dev and staging share a filter snapshot; prod rebuilds its own nightly. False-positive rates differ per environment, so don't copy settings blindly. Prod currently runs with these configuration values.

deployment values, kajep-kageg:
[praix]
host = praix.paliqcorp.corp
user = praix_svc
database = praix_prod

## 2.8.0 — Changed defaults

The `tailgrub` CLI no longer follows symlinked log directories by default; pass an explicit flag to restore old behavior. Redaction of bearer-token patterns is now on by default. Session recording is disabled unless an audit profile is loaded. Reviewers should note that these defaults derive from the shipped baseline, which now reads as follows.

deployment values, yadug-bawif:
[framir]
team = pelox
access_code = ac_a38ab2
owner = tamion.julael
host = framir.tolvaqlabs.test
port = 11211
peer = tammir.zemvargrid.local
salt = 2215ef03
pin = 1541

**Q: How do I restore the StallSense occupancy feed if the aggregator loses its keyring?**

A: The Garagely ingest node keeps an encrypted snapshot of stall counts for the Brindleton deck. Restoring it requires re-initializing the keyring from the sealed backup, which we rotate quarterly. When prompted during restore, enter the recovery passphrase shown directly below.

unlock words, kahif-bajep: druix-sormir-fenys